What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a parttime asset protection associate?

To thrive as a Part-Time Asset Protection Associate, you need a keen eye for detail, basic knowledge of security protocols,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with CCTV systems, inventory tracking software, and incident reporting tools is typically required. Strong observational skills, integrity, and effective communication help you respond to incidents and interact with both customers and staff. These abilities are crucial for minimizing loss, ensuring store safety, and maintaining a secure shopping environment.

What are some common challenges faced by parttime asset protection associates, and how can they be addressed?

Part-time asset protection associates often face challenges such as balancing multiple responsibilities, maintaining vigilance during busy store hours, and effectively communicating with both customers and team members. Since hours may vary, it's important to stay updated on store policies and procedures to ensure consistency. Building strong relationships with colleagues and proactively seeking feedback from supervisors can help address these challenges, making it easier to prevent losses and respond to security incidents efficiently.

What is the difference between Parttime Asset Protection vs Parttime Security Guard?

AspectParttime Asset ProtectionParttime Security Guard
CredentialsHigh school diploma, sometimes specialized trainingHigh school diploma, security license
Work EnvironmentRetail stores, malls, warehousesPublic spaces, events, buildings
Employer & IndustryRetail companies, shopping centersSecurity firms, private clients

Parttime Asset Protection focuses on preventing theft and loss in retail environments, often involving surveillance and customer service. Parttime Security Guard provides general security services in various settings, including patrolling and access control. While both roles require similar credentials and work in security-related environments, Asset Protection emphasizes loss prevention specific to retail, whereas Security Guards serve broader security functions.

What is a parttime asset protection job?

Part-time asset protection jobs involve working to prevent theft, fraud, and loss within a retail or corporate environment, but on a part-time schedule. These roles typically include monitoring surveillance systems, conducting security checks, investigating incidents, and collaborating with management to improve safety protocols. Employees in this position work fewer hours than full-time staff, making it ideal for students or those needing flexible schedules. The main goal is to protect company assets while ensuring a safe environment for customers and employees.

Job description

The Maintenance and Housekeeping Associate drives sales and delivers a positive customer and associate experience by maintaining a clean, safe, and inviting store environment. This role performs daily cleaning activities, maintenance tasks, and supply replenishment. The Maintenance and Housekeeping Associate has high standards for hygiene and an attention for detail. This is an hourly position.
What you will do
  • Demonstrate ownership and initiative in achieving personal goals, store objectives, and daily priorities.

  • Maintain cleanliness throughout all areas of the store by dusting, vacuuming, sweeping, cleaning mirrors, and collecting trash, hangers, and sensor tags.

  • Clean restrooms and associate breakroom thoroughly, sanitizing all surfaces and breakroom appliances and restocking essential items.

  • Replenish supplies at registers, including bags, boxes, and tissue paper and remove unnecessary items. Organize and replenish cleaning and maintenance supplies to promote efficiency and ensure ease of access by store team.

  • Support store safety by identifying hazards, such as spills, icy sidewalks, and broken glass, and resolving promptly.

  • Replace interior and exterior lights, maintaining a well-lit store environment.

  • Leverage training tools, use resources, and embrace feedback to build knowledge of operational processes and procedures and strengthen performance. Stay informed of products, promotions, policies, and store events to enhance execution.

  • Contribute to a positive store culture by building connections with teammates, sharing knowledge, and celebrating individual and team achievements.

  • Enhance in-store customer experience by warmly acknowledging and assisting customers, supporting the store during peak traffic and coverage periods, and completing other tasks as assigned.

  • Follow asset protection procedures, safety guidelines, and security protocols, supporting store shortage control and minimizing risk.

Skills and Abilities
  • Dedication to customer service and a drive to achieve store objectives.

  • Skills and experience to perform in the role and a commitment to continuously learn.

  • Ability to use data and guidance to support timely and effective decisions.

  • Ability to take ownership of assigned tasks and contribute to store success.

  • Communicate with excellence.

  • Comfortable with technology, including smartphones, tablet computers and Windows-based operating systems.

  • Available to work a flexible schedule based on business needs, including nights, weekends, and holidays.

  • Must regularly move around all store areas and be accessible to customers.

  • Must bend, reach, stretch for product as well as lift, carry, and move at least 40 lbs.
